1. A reciprocating cutting blade apparatus comprising:
a pair of reciprocating cutting blades, each of the pair of reciprocating cutting blades extending longitudinally in a direction parallel to an X direction of a Cartesian coordinate system and having teeth extending in a Y direction, and each of the pair of reciprocating cutting blades disposed to overlap one another in a thickness direction parallel to a Z-axis of the Cartesian coordinate system;
a first support member and a second support member spaced apart from each other by a distance and configured to sandwich and reciprocably support the pair of reciprocating cutting blades; and
a transmission case to which the first support member and the second support member maintaining the distance therebetween are mounted,
the transmission case including:
a grease inlet and a first grease reservoir provided on first side of the first support member, the first grease reservoir being configured to accumulate grease poured from the grease inlet and;
a second grease reservoir provided on a second side of the second support member and configured to accumulate the grease poured from the grease inlet,
the first support member including a through-hole configured to communicate with the first grease reservoir,
the second support member including a through-hole configured to communicate with the second grease reservoir, and
the pair of reciprocating cutting blades including through-holes configured to allow communication between the through-hole of the first support member and the through-hole of the second support member, respectively.
